Gold (Au) - Chemical Elements.com
Symbol: Au Atomic Number: 79 Atomic Mass: 196.96655 amu Melting Point: 1064.43 °C (1337.5801 K, 1947.9741 °F) Boiling Point: 2807.0 °C (3080.15 K, 5084.6 °F) Number of Protons/Electrons: 79 Number of Neutrons: 118 Classification: Transition Metal Crystal Structure: Cubic Density @ 293 K: 19.32 g/cm 3 Color: Gold Atomic Structure

Gold (Au) – Periodic Table (Element Information & More)
Sep 1, 2024 · The atomic mass of gold is 196.97 u and its density is 19.3 g/cm 3. The melting point of gold is 1064 °C and its boiling point is 2970 °C. Gold has many isotopes and out of the naturally occurring isotopes, 197 Au is the most abundant (almost 100%). The crystal structure of gold is FCC (face centered cubic).

WebElements Periodic Table » Gold » crystal structures
Gold crystal structure image (ball and stick style). Gold crystal structure image (space filling style). The closest Au-Au separation is 288.4 pm implying a gold metallic radius of 144.2 pm
Gold - 79 Au: properties of free atoms - WebElements
Aug 2, 2018 · Gold atoms have 79 electrons and the shell structure is 2.8.18.32.18.1. The ground state electron configuration of ground state gaseous neutral gold is [Xe]. 4f14. 5d10. 6s1 and the term symbol is 2S1/2. Schematic electronic configuration of gold. Gold - The Chemical Elements
Apr 9, 2020 · With the periodic table symbol Au, atomic number 79, the atomic mass of 196.967 g.mol -1, and electronic configuration [Xe] 4f145d106s1, gold is a ductile metal that reaches its boiling point at 2836°C, 5137°F, 3109 K, while the melting point is achieved at 1064.18°C, 1947.52°F, 1337.33 K.
Gold: Definition, Structure, Chemical and Physical Properties
May 15, 2023 · Gold is found in compounds with oxidation states ranging from 1 to +5, but Au(I) and Au(III) predominate in its chemistry. The most frequent oxidation state with soft ligands, including thioethers, thiolates, and organophosphines, is Au(I), also known as the aurous ion.
